Sebelius: "Health care costs are crushing families"
By Kayleigh Harvey - Talk Radio News Service
At her nomination hearing Governor Kathleen Sebelius (D-Kan.) noted the challenges she faces if confirmed, stating, “Health care costs are crushing families, businesses, and government budgets. Since 2000, health insurance premiums have almost doubled and an additional 9 million Americans have become uninsured."
